BIVARIATE CUBIC B-SPLINES RELATIVE TO CROSS-CUT TRIANGULATIONS

         

摘要

<正> In this paper we prove that there are no locally supported bivariate Gk-1spline functionsof degree k on cross-cut grid partitioned regions with no more than three lines meeting at acommon vertex.We also give explicit expressions of bivariate C~1 cubic B-spline with smallestlocal support on cross-cut triangular grid partitioned regions where each vertex is theintersection of three lines.Properly normalized,these B-splines are proved to be uniquelydetermined and form a partition of unity.Furthermore,the corresponding waxationdiminishing bivariate spline operators are proved to preserve all linear polynomials of twovariables.These facts enable us to give error estimates for approximation by bivariate C~1cubic splines for functions of class C,C~1 and C~2.
